IMAGE READING APPARATUS AND METHOD, WITH A MOVABLE LIGHT REFLECTING SURFACE
An image reading apparatus includes an image capturing module for capturing an image of a document, a light source, a movable light reflecting surface having a white color, a driving module for moving the light reflecting surface into a first position at which the light reflecting surface reflects light from the light source and a second position at which the light reflecting surface does not reflect light from the light source, and a control module for controlling the driving module to move the light reflecting surface. The control module determines the second position by moving the light reflecting surface by a predetermined quantity from the first position determined based on an image obtained by the image capturing module.
IMAGE READING APPARATUS WITH A CAM TO MOVE A LIGHT REFLECTING SURFACE
An image reading apparatus includes a light source and a movable light reflecting surface provided to be capable to move to a first position to reflect light from the light source. The image reading apparatus includes a cam to move the light reflecting surface and having a first portion, a driving module for providing a driving force, and a transmission member for rotating the cam with the driving force provided by the driving module, the transmission member having a second portion, wherein the transmission member moves the light reflecting surface to a predetermined position by rotating the cam, and by bringing the second portion into contact with the first portion to hold the light reflecting surface at the predetermined position when there is no driving force.
IMAGE READING DEVICE
An image reading device includes: a sensor module having a light source and a plurality of sensors; a white reference plate; and an image processor that generates correction data to be used for shading correction and performs the shading correction on image signals, using the correction data. The light source is configured to switch between at least a first luminous intensity and a second luminous intensity lower than the first luminous intensity. The image processor acquires intermediate data by causing the plurality of sensors to acquire an image signal of the white reference plate illuminated with the second luminous intensity, generates black correction data, based on the intermediate data, and performs the shading correction, using the black correction data, so that a density unevenness, in an image, caused by interference between image signals from the plurality of sensors.
PRINTER THAT PERFORMS SHADING CORRECTION AND METHOD FOR OPERATING THE SAME
A printer includes a discharge unit, a first printing unit disposed along a sheet conveying path extending from the discharge unit and configured to print an image on a first sheet while the first sheet is conveyed from the discharge unit to the first printing unit and then to the discharge unit, a second printing unit disposed farther from the discharge unit than the first printing unit along the sheet conveyance path and configured to print an image on a second sheet while the second sheet is conveyed towards the discharge unit therethrough, a scanning unit disposed along the sheet conveying path between the discharge unit and the first printing unit, and configured to scan a surface of the first sheet, and a control unit configured to perform a shading correction of the scanning unit using the second sheet as a white reference.
IMAGE READING APPARATUS
An image reading apparatus is provided with an identification information reading unit (reading unit, NFC reader, and identification information acquisition unit) which acquires identification information by reading the identification information from a section to be read at which identifiable identification information is recorded for each individual carrier sheet and which is provided at a joining section of the carrier sheet in which two transparent sheets for pinching an original document are joined at a portion of a peripheral edge portion; and a processor which performs a process which is associated with the identification information read by the identification information reading unit.

IMAGE READING DEVICE
An image reading device has an image processor that generates correction data to be used for shading correction and performs the shading correction using the correction data. The image processor generates intermediate data with a predetermined density level, generates intermediate data in different positions in the sub-scanning direction based on image signals of a first reference plate and a second reference plate disposed in the different positions, generates first and second black correction data based on the respective intermediate data, generates black correction data according to the sub-scanning direction based on both the black correction data, and performs the shading correction using the black correction data in the respective positions in the sub-scanning direction.
Color measurement device, image forming apparatus, electronic equipment, color chart, and color measurement method
A printer moves a color chart relative to a spectrometer that carries out spectral measurement on the color chart. The color chart, which is a color measurement target of the printer, includes a color patch and a white portion that is positioned in a first position and a second position. The first position and the second position interpose a color measurement position, in which the color patch is disposed, along a predetermined direction. The printer acquires measured values by carrying out spectral measurement for the color measurement position, the first position, and the second position, determines a reference value corresponding to the color measurement position based on the measured values of the first position and the second position, and determines a color measurement result of the color patch based on the measured value of the color measurement position and the reference value.
Image reading device
A control unit performs a reading operation in a first mode in which a document on a document stand is read by moving a carriage which includes a reading portion, and in a second mode in which a document which is transported by a document transport unit is read using the carriage which is located at a reading position. The device includes a first white reference plate which is arranged in a first white reference reading position which is a standby position in the first mode, and a second white reference plate which is arranged on a side opposite to the first white reference plate by interposing a reading position in the second mode therebetween in the sub-scanning direction.
IMAGE READING APPARATUS, CONTROL METHOD FOR IMAGE READING APPARATUS, AND STORAGE MEDIUM
There is provided a control method for an image reading apparatus including a document conveyance unit configured to convey a document, a first reading unit configured to read a first surface of the document conveyed by the document conveyance unit, and a second reading unit configured to read a second surface of the document conveyed by the document conveyance unit, includes setting a two-sided reading mode for reading the first surface and the second surface of the document, and starting initial adjustment operation of the second reading unit in response to setting of the two-sided reading mode.
